Open admissions means that any prospective student who has completed high school or attained a GED certificate may enroll in classes. A qualifying GPA or standardized test scores (SAT or ACT) scores are not necessary for to attend these schools with open admissions policies.

How much does it cost to attend open admissions college in Kentucky?   The average annual in-state college tuition in Kentucky was $14,642 for the 2021-2022 academic year. This is a change of $805 from the 2019-2020 average of $13,837 and represents a 5.82% annual increase. The list of Kentucky open admissions colleges below provides school specific cost and value rating.

Our guide surveyed tuition data from the 37 open admissions colleges and universities in Kentucky, the most popular being Bluegrass Community and Technical College with 3,729 full time students and an in-state tuition list price of $4,296. Lindsey Wilson College is the most expensive open admissions school in Kentucky with an in-state tuition of $25,440.
